Top 5 places Where to hang out with friends in Vancouver

1- Vancouver Seawall

If you’re looking for something active, head over to the Vancouver Seawall and walk or bike along the path.
You’ll find that following this route, whether on foot or by bicycle, is one of the best ways to discover Vancouver with your friends.

We all know that the city is known for mountains, but the seawall is primarily flat, making it an easy ride or walk for those of all abilities and ages.

There are plenty of places to stop for a coffee or snack break on your way!

2- Granville Island Market

If your goal is to meet new people, why not participate in one of the free walking tours? Companies like Vancouver Free Walking Tours at Granville Island Market are offered.

Granville Island Public Market is a spot that foodies and gourmands won’t want to miss on their tour of Vancouver.

It’s a great way to explore this beautiful city and be introduced to other visitors exploring the area.

3- Kitsilano

Or Kits, for short, is a trendy part of Vancouver that’s home to one of the city’s best beaches.

Whether you’re into water sports, sunbathing, beachfront jogging, Kits has you covered, with stunning views of the nearby mountains sealing the deal.

In addition to the beach and oceanfront, the area has several coffees and walking trails, and a vibrant shopping strip lies a few blocks south on West Fourth Avenue.

4- Gastown

If you decide on a shopping day with your friend in one neighborhood while you’re in Vancouver, it should probably be Gastown.

The oldest part of the city, Gastown, is an attractive area of historical significance, which explains why it has been officially designated a national historic site.

Gastown has excellent First Nations art galleries worth checking out for unique keepsakes such as silver jewelry, art pieces, and carvings.

5- English Bay

Located at the far end of trendy Denman Street, English Bay is Vancouver’s annual January Polar Bear Swim.

English Bay offers shopping and high-end restaurants, and it is also a popular outdoor area where people come to walk, bike, rollerblade, or hang out with friends in Vancouver.
